当前位置:首页 > 综合资讯 > 正文
黑狐家游戏

服务器负载均衡是什么意思啊,深入解析服务器负载均衡,原理、应用与优势

服务器负载均衡是什么意思啊,深入解析服务器负载均衡,原理、应用与优势

服务器负载均衡,指将用户请求分配到多台服务器,优化资源利用,提高系统稳定性。其原理基于算法,实现请求分发。应用广泛,如网站、游戏等。优势包括提升性能、增加可用性、简化维...

服务器负载均衡,指将用户请求分配到多台服务器,优化资源利用,提高系统稳定性。其原理基于算法,实现请求分发。应用广泛,如网站、游戏等。优势包括提升性能、增加可用性、简化维护等。

随着互联网技术的飞速发展,企业对服务器性能的要求越来越高,在服务器资源有限的情况下,如何合理分配负载,确保系统稳定、高效地运行,成为了企业关注的焦点,本文将深入解析服务器负载均衡的概念、原理、应用及优势,帮助读者全面了解这一关键技术。

服务器负载均衡的定义

服务器负载均衡(Server Load Balancing,简称SLB)是指将多个服务器连接起来,形成一个服务器集群,通过某种算法将用户请求分配到不同的服务器上,实现负载分担,提高系统性能和可用性。

服务器负载均衡是什么意思啊,深入解析服务器负载均衡,原理、应用与优势

服务器负载均衡的原理

1、轮询算法(Round Robin):将用户请求按照时间顺序依次分配到各个服务器上,每个服务器处理相同数量的请求。

2、加权轮询算法(Weighted Round Robin):在轮询算法的基础上,根据服务器性能对请求进行处理,性能较高的服务器分配更多的请求,性能较低的服务器分配较少的请求。

3、最少连接算法(Least Connections):将用户请求分配到当前连接数最少的服务器上,降低服务器的连接压力。

4、IP哈希算法(IP Hash):根据用户IP地址,将请求分配到对应的服务器上,确保同一用户在会话期间始终访问同一服务器。

5、基于内容的负载均衡(Content-Based Load Balancing):根据请求内容,将请求分配到具有相应处理能力的服务器上。

服务器负载均衡的应用

1、高并发场景:在电商、社交、游戏等高并发场景中,负载均衡可以有效提高系统性能,降低服务器压力。

服务器负载均衡是什么意思啊,深入解析服务器负载均衡,原理、应用与优势

2、分布式系统:在分布式系统中,负载均衡可以将请求分配到不同的节点,提高系统的可用性和可靠性。

3、异构服务器集群:在异构服务器集群中,负载均衡可以根据服务器性能,将请求分配到合适的服务器上。

4、弹性伸缩:在云环境中,负载均衡可以根据实际负载动态调整服务器数量,实现弹性伸缩。

服务器负载均衡的优势

1、提高系统性能:负载均衡可以将请求分配到多个服务器上,提高系统整体处理能力。

2、增强系统可用性:在服务器故障时,负载均衡可以将请求分配到其他正常服务器,确保系统稳定运行。

3、降低单点故障风险:通过负载均衡,将请求分散到多个服务器,降低单点故障对系统的影响。

服务器负载均衡是什么意思啊,深入解析服务器负载均衡,原理、应用与优势

4、优化资源利用率:负载均衡可以根据服务器性能,将请求分配到合适的服务器,提高资源利用率。

5、支持动态调整:负载均衡可以根据实际负载动态调整服务器数量,实现弹性伸缩。

服务器负载均衡是一种关键技术,可以有效提高系统性能、可用性和可靠性,通过合理配置负载均衡策略,企业可以应对高并发、分布式系统等复杂场景,实现业务的稳定、高效运行,在云计算、大数据等时代背景下,负载均衡技术将发挥越来越重要的作用。

黑狐家游戏

发表评论

最新文章